print()
results = []
for i in range(1,10):
results.append(i*2)
print(results) # [2, 4, 6, 8, 10, 12, 14, 16, 18]
results = []
for i in range(1, 10):
results += [i * 2]
print(results) # [2, 4, 6, 8, 10, 12, 14, 16, 18]
# list comprehension
results = [i * 2 for i in range(1, 10)]
print(results)
list comprehension문법을 사용하면 코드의 가독성이 늘어날 뿐 아니라
실제 성능에도 영향을 준다고 합니다.